Henry A. Keck was born in Carlos Township, Douglas County, Minnesota, January 5, 1898, the son of Louis and Emma (Schwartfeger) Keck. When Henry was four years old the family moved to Alexandria for two years and then to Hudson Township where they farmed until 1911. At that time the family returned to Alexandria and the Kecks had made this their home since. On February 5, 1924, Henry was united in marriage to Evanell Lindstrom in Alexandria and they became members of the First Congregational United Church of Christ. Mr. Keck was involved in the oil business in Alexandria beginning in 1922 and retiring in 1965, a period of 43 years. He also served as Mayor of Alexandria from 1941-1943 and served on the City Council. Henry was also a director and appraiser for the Alexandria Federal Savings and Loan for sixteen years.
He died at the Douglas County Hospital, May 30, 1986, at the age of 88 years.
Henry is survived by wife: Evanell Keck of Alexandria; daughter: Majel (Mrs. Boyd) Berg of Minneapolis; son: Henry A. Keck, Jr., of Albuquerque, NM. Also surviving are five grandchildren and three great grandchildren.
Funeral services were June 2, 1986 at the First Congregational United Church of Christ, Alexandria, Minnesota with Rev. Bruce Kott officiating. Interment was in the Kinkead Cemetery, Alexandria, Minnesota. Pallbearers were Douglas Berg, Jeffrey Berg, Richard Berg, John Keck, Charles Keck, and Todd Whiting. Arrangements with Anderson Funeral Home.
(Lake Region Press, 6 June 1986)
